Bank North Receives Banking License, Expects to Commence Lending in October

Previously doing business as B-North, Bank North has been granted a banking license (Authorised with Restrictions or ‘AWR’) by the UK’s Prudential Regulation Authority (PRA). UK’s Digital Bank Monzo Is Facing Potential Money Laundering Charges by FCA, Reports Annual Loss of £130 Million

Gavel Court Legal Trial Law rawpixel unsplash

UK-based digital bank Monzo is currently facing a civil and criminal money-laundering investigation that is being carried out by the Financial Conduct Authority (FCA). Challenger Banks to Add 435M Accounts By 2026: Report

A new report from ABI Research predicts neobanks and challenger banks will nearly quadruple their number of accounts over the next five years The top 57 neo and challenger banks should grow their accounts from the 2020s 155 million to 590.6 million by 2026 due… Read More
